		<description>As a founding member of the Fair Trade Federation (FTF), one of the oldest and largest nonprofit fair trade retailers, and one of the World&#039;s Most Ethical Companies, Ten Thousand Villages strives to improve the livelihood of tens of thousands of disadvantaged artisans in 38 countries by establishing a sustainable market for handmade products in North America. 
 
As a nonprofit, we achieve this mission by building long term buying relationships in places where skilled artisan partners lack opportunities for stable income.  Product sales help pay for food, education, healthcare and housing for artisans who would otherwise be unemployed or underemployed. 
 
Our commitment to support artisans around the globe is strengthened through fair trade compensation practices including cash advances and prompt payments.  More than 60 years later, and as the company continues to grow, Ten Thousand Villages has become increasingly conscious of the need to marry the concept of fair trade with healthy and environmentally sustainable business practices.

Today, Ten Thousand Villages continues to carry out a conscious approach toward minimizing an environmental impact.  From store operations to product selection to marketing practices, Ten Thousand Villages strives to meet the “triple bottom line” of economic, environmental and social sustainability.
